Episode 30 🎧

In the NeuroDADverse this week, Ben and Dan return for the first episode of 2026, reflecting on the strange reset that comes with a new year, especially when neurodivergent family life doesn’t pause for calendars.


This week includes a significant medical scare, a broken foot, hospital visits, difficult sensory decisions, and the careful balance between safety, regulation, and trust. Alongside the challenges, the episode becomes a powerful reflection on how far their children and they as parents have come.


In this episode, we talk about:

•The emotional weight of returning to routine after Christmas

•Managing medical situations with ND children

•Pain stimming, safety concerns, and regulation trade-offs

•Hospital visits, advocacy, and processing time

•When independence and vulnerability coexist

•How injuries highlight both progress and ongoing support needs

•Calm wins after chaotic weeks

•Reflecting honestly on the highs and lows of 2025

•Why resilience doesn’t mean “finding things easy”

•Hopes for 2026 that focus on joy, autonomy, and self-belief

•Letting go of pressure and trusting your child’s pace
